Ski lifts at the ski resort Perisher

The cog railway (Skitube) takes you from the Bullocks Flat base station up to Perisher Valley and further on to Blue Cow. A separate ticket is required for the railway, and you need to change trains at Perisher Valley to continue to Blue Cow. In Perisher Valley, you'll find Australia's first eight-seater chairlift. The ski slopes are served by several chairlifts as well as many drag and platter lifts. Most of the chairlifts are fixed-grip and some are a bit older. None of the chairlifts have weather protection hoods. Conveyor belts complete the range of lift options.
